Abstract

The invention relates to the technical field of power transmission, in particular to a power cabinet convenient for heat dissipation, which comprises a device main body, the device main body comprises a device shell, a storage box is embedded in the bottom end of the device shell, a handle is fixedly connected to the surface of the storage box, a vent hole is formed in the bottom end of the handle, and a sliding block is fixedly connected to the bottom end of the handle; the sliding block is slidably connected with the device shell, a limiting pin is slidably connected into the device shell, the end, away from the device shell, of the limiting pin is embedded into a groove formed in the side face of the storage box, a limiting spring is fixedly connected between the limiting pin and the device shell, and the front face of the storage box is connected with the device shell through a locking mechanism. The side face of the inner wall of the device shell is fixedly connected with a control mechanism. In the using process, heat dissipation is facilitated, and the interior of the device can be kept dry.

technical field [0001] The invention relates to the technical field of electric power transportation, in particular to a power cabinet convenient for heat dissipation. Background technique [0002] In people's daily life, electricity is indispensable. In the home environment, people use electricity for lighting, heating and entertainment. In the process of electricity transportation, the electricity generated by the power station is usually converted into high-voltage electricity. And use high-voltage transmission lines to transport electricity to people's living areas, and then use transformers to convert high-voltage currents into low-voltage currents. And transported to people's surroundings, the current enters thousands of households under the distribution of power cabinets for people to use.
